Click … tec bagWeb28 de abr. de 2024 · Where necessary, a more fine-grained approach (i.e., blocking certain ICMP types) may be preferred. Your router must accept at least ICMP types 0, 3 (all codes), 4, 5 (all codes), 11 (all codes) and 12 (all codes).
